Understanding iOS: The Heart of Apple's Ecosystem
iOS is, without a doubt, the cornerstone of Apple's mobile empire. It's the operating system that powers iPhones, iPads, and iPod touches. From the sleek user interface to the underlying architecture, iOS is designed to provide a seamless and intuitive user experience. But what makes it tick? Let's take a closer look.
At its core, iOS is built on a Unix-based kernel, which provides a robust and secure foundation. This foundation allows for efficient resource management, multitasking, and a high degree of stability. Apple has always prioritized user privacy and security, and iOS reflects this commitment. The operating system employs various security measures, including sandboxing, encryption, and regular security updates, to protect user data. The user interface is another key aspect of iOS. Apple is known for its design aesthetic, and iOS is no exception. The interface is clean, intuitive, and consistent across all devices. The use of gestures, animations, and haptic feedback enhances the user experience and makes interacting with the device a pleasure. Apple also provides a rich ecosystem of apps through the App Store. Developers create apps for iOS using Apple's development tools and frameworks, ensuring that apps are optimized for the platform and adhere to Apple's design guidelines. This curated approach helps maintain a high level of quality and security within the app ecosystem. iOS is also constantly evolving. Apple releases major updates every year, introducing new features, improvements, and security patches. These updates not only enhance the user experience but also keep the devices secure and compatible with the latest technologies. This commitment to continuous improvement is one of the reasons why iOS remains a leading mobile operating system. From a developer's perspective, iOS offers a well-documented and supportive environment. Apple provides extensive documentation, tools, and frameworks to help developers create high-quality apps. The Swift programming language, developed by Apple, is particularly well-suited for iOS development, offering performance, safety, and ease of use. This developer-friendly approach encourages innovation and ensures that the App Store is filled with a wide variety of apps to meet the needs of users.

Project Management (PM) Technologies: Keeping Things on Track
Now, let's explore Project Management (PM) technologies. Project management is the art and science of leading a team to achieve project goals within a specific timeframe and budget. It involves planning, organizing, and controlling various aspects of a project, from defining the scope to managing resources and mitigating risks. PM technologies are the tools and techniques used to make this process more efficient and effective. This is how project management helps ensure that everything is executed with precision.
PM technologies include software applications, methodologies, and frameworks that help project managers and teams plan, execute, and monitor projects. These technologies can range from simple task management tools to complex project portfolio management systems. The primary goal of PM technologies is to improve project outcomes by providing better visibility, communication, and control. One of the most common types of PM technologies is project management software. These applications help project managers create project plans, assign tasks, track progress, manage resources, and communicate with team members. Some popular project management software include Asana, Trello, Jira, and Microsoft Project. These tools offer various features, such as task management, Gantt charts, Kanban boards, and reporting capabilities. In addition to software, PM technologies also encompass various methodologies and frameworks. Agile, Scrum, and Waterfall are among the most popular project management methodologies. Agile focuses on flexibility and iterative development, while Waterfall follows a linear, sequential approach. Scrum is a popular agile framework that emphasizes collaboration, accountability, and iterative progress toward a well-defined project goal. These methodologies provide a structured approach to project management, helping teams organize their work, manage risks, and adapt to changes. Another important aspect of PM technologies is communication and collaboration tools. Effective communication is essential for the success of any project. PM technologies often integrate communication tools, such as instant messaging, video conferencing, and email, to facilitate communication among team members. These tools allow team members to share information, provide updates, and resolve issues quickly and efficiently.
